British sprinter Amy Hunt secured a bronze medal in the women's 200m at the Diamond League Final in Brussels, clocking a season's best time of 22.16 seconds. Despite finishing nearly half a second behind Olympic champion Julien Alfred, Hunt expressed satisfaction with her performance, calling it one of the better races of her career given the conditions and her fatigue.
In other news from the event, pole vault world record holder Mondo Duplantis was forced to withdraw due to a leg issue that has troubled him throughout the outdoor season, raising concerns about his fitness. The Diamond League Final in Brussels featured a star-studded field competing for season titles across various track and field disciplines.
